Mission Cloud launches AI optimization service for AWS users

Managed cloud service provider Mission Cloud Services Inc. today announced the launch of Mission AI Foundation, a new service designed to help businesses optimize their AI solutions on Amazon Web Services Inc. while also adhering to best practices and cost management.

The service has been created to assist companies that are interested in AI but are often put off by significant challenges and concerns, such as financial management, security and knowledge gaps. The idea of Mission AI Foundation is to give companies who are eager to harness the power of AI a way to move forward safely and efficiently.

The service combines support, engineering, strategy and guidance to help organizations manage their cloud infrastructure and build for the future of AI. It’s built on five pillars of continuous engagement: AI solutions optimization and architecture guidance, continuous cost and financial management, best practices and cloud governance, 24/7 enterprise support with AWS backing, and cloud strategy for transformative technology adoption.

“To build robust AI workloads, it’s crucial to have well-architected cloud infrastructure as the foundation,” said Ted Stuart, president and chief operating officer of Mission Cloud. “Mission AI Foundation provides the expertise and tools necessary to optimize both AI solutions and the underlying cloud and data architecture, manage costs, and align with best practices.”

Key features of Mission AI Foundation include access to a team of certified cloud analysts, technical account managers, solutions architects and AI engineers. The service focuses on improving token usage to ensure economical and high-performing AI operations, offering Engineer Assist — AI with pay-as-you-go engineering support.

Additionally, AI Foundation provides continuous guidance on prompting best practices to enhance accuracy, optimize templates, reduce hallucinations and improve overall model performance. The service also offers 24/7 support with AWS Enterprise-level service level agreements and includes Large Language Model Operations to build and maintain a dedicated operations pipeline.

“This comprehensive approach enables our customers to focus on innovation and growth, knowing their AI initiatives are built on a reliable, secure and efficient platform,” Stuart added.

AI Foundation leverages Mission Control, the company’s cloud services platform, along with Amazon QuickSight and Amazon Q, to provide users with detailed cost visualization and management tools.
